Understanding Pico Projector Battery Life

Before we dive into charging times, it’s essential to understand the battery life of pico projectors. The battery life of a pico projector depends on several factors, including the device’s brightness, resolution, and usage patterns. On average, a pico projector can last anywhere from 1 to 4 hours on a single charge, depending on the device’s specifications.

Factors Affecting Battery Life

Several factors can affect the battery life of a pico projector, including:

  • Brightness: The brighter the projector, the more power it consumes, which can reduce battery life.
  • Resolution: Higher resolution projectors tend to consume more power than lower resolution ones.
  • Usage patterns: If you’re using your pico projector for extended periods, the battery life will be shorter than if you’re using it for short intervals.

Charging Times: What to Expect

Now that we’ve covered battery life, let’s talk about charging times. The charging time of a pico projector depends on several factors, including the device’s battery capacity, charging method, and charger type.

Battery Capacity

The battery capacity of a pico projector is measured in milliampere-hours (mAh). A higher mAh rating means the battery can store more power, which can result in longer battery life. However, it also means the battery will take longer to charge.

Typical Battery Capacities

Here are some typical battery capacities for pico projectors:

| Battery Capacity | Typical Charging Time |
| — | — |
| 2000mAh | 2-3 hours |
| 3000mAh | 3-4 hours |
| 5000mAh | 5-6 hours |

Charging Methods

There are two common charging methods for pico projectors: USB charging and wall adapter charging. USB charging is convenient, but it can take longer to charge the battery. Wall adapter charging, on the other hand, is faster but requires a power outlet.

USB Charging

USB charging is a convenient way to charge your pico projector, especially when you’re on the go. However, it can take longer to charge the battery, typically 2-4 hours.

Wall Adapter Charging

Wall adapter charging is faster than USB charging, typically taking 1-3 hours to fully charge the battery.

Fast Charging: A Game-Changer for Pico Projectors

Fast charging is a technology that allows devices to charge faster than usual. Some pico projectors come with fast charging capabilities, which can significantly reduce charging times.

How Fast Charging Works

Fast charging works by increasing the voltage and current supplied to the battery. This allows the battery to charge faster, but it also generates more heat, which can affect the battery’s lifespan.

Benefits of Fast Charging

Fast charging has several benefits, including:

  • Reduced charging times: Fast charging can reduce charging times by up to 50%.
  • Increased convenience: Fast charging allows you to quickly top up your battery, making it perfect for on-the-go use.

What is a pico projector and how does it work?

A pico projector is a small, portable projector that uses light-emitting diodes (LEDs) or lasers to project images onto a screen or surface. It works by using a digital light processing (DLP) chip or a liquid crystal on silicon (LCoS) chip to create the images, which are then magnified and projected through a lens.

Pico projectors are often used for presentations, entertainment, and educational purposes. They are popular due to their compact size, low power consumption, and ability to project high-quality images. Pico projectors can be connected to various devices such as smartphones, laptops, and tablets, making them a convenient option for on-the-go use.

How long does it take to charge a pico projector?

The charging time of a pico projector varies depending on the model, battery capacity, and charging method. On average, it can take anywhere from 2 to 5 hours to fully charge a pico projector. Some models may have faster charging times, while others may take longer.

It’s essential to check the manufacturer’s specifications for the recommended charging time and method. Some pico projectors may come with a quick-charge feature, which can significantly reduce the charging time. It’s also important to note that overcharging can damage the battery, so it’s recommended to unplug the projector once it’s fully charged.

What factors affect the charging time of a pico projector?

Several factors can affect the charging time of a pico projector, including the battery capacity, charging method, and power source. A higher-capacity battery will generally take longer to charge, while a lower-capacity battery will charge faster. The charging method, such as USB or wall adapter, can also impact the charging time.

Additionally, the power source can affect the charging time. For example, charging a pico projector from a USB port on a computer may take longer than charging it from a wall adapter. It’s also worth noting that some pico projectors may have power-saving features that can affect the charging time.

Can I use a pico projector while it’s charging?

Yes, most pico projectors can be used while they’re charging. However, it’s essential to check the manufacturer’s specifications to confirm this. Some models may have specific requirements or restrictions for use during charging.

Using a pico projector while it’s charging can be convenient, but it may also affect the charging time. The projector’s battery may not charge as efficiently while it’s in use, which can prolong the charging time. It’s recommended to check the manufacturer’s guidelines for using the projector during charging.

How can I extend the battery life of my pico projector?

To extend the battery life of your pico projector, it’s recommended to follow proper charging and maintenance procedures. Avoid overcharging the battery, as this can cause damage and reduce its lifespan. It’s also essential to store the projector in a cool, dry place when not in use.

Additionally, adjusting the projector’s settings can help extend the battery life. For example, reducing the brightness or turning off unnecessary features can help conserve power. Regularly cleaning the projector’s lens and filters can also help maintain its performance and extend its lifespan.

Can I replace the battery of my pico projector?

In some cases, it may be possible to replace the battery of your pico projector. However, this depends on the model and manufacturer. Some pico projectors may have removable batteries, while others may have integrated batteries that cannot be replaced.

If you’re considering replacing the battery, it’s essential to check the manufacturer’s specifications and guidelines. You may need to purchase a replacement battery from the manufacturer or a authorized dealer. It’s also important to note that replacing the battery may void the warranty or affect the projector’s performance.
